China Zhejiang Hangzhou Alibaba Cloud
Websites on 121.40.32.235
- Domain names that have been bound:
- 2017-02-14-----2017-02-14www.topstao.com
- website server lookup history
- www.hstyjy.com
- iptv234.com
- mmdh3.com
- 492773.com
- www.zmx168.com
- www.hao123hk.com
- tqingqu.com
- www.bjzcp168.com
- 520390.com
- 492174.com
- ht56.vip
- 49210.cc
- 7w7w.cc
- porncp.com
- www.bo305.com
- www.xxnvideo.com
- xx9.com
- ww2.lolitacity.org
- 4966cp141.com
- 67919.com
- hosting ip address lookup history
- 42.81.98.35
- 111.229.118.125
- 156.235.135.142
- 3.165.255.126
- 142.111.45.74
- 107.148.74.253
- 140.188.108.54
- 58.195.99.5
- 23.206.30.254
- 147.255.48.39
- 104.164.59.141
- 103.196.101.21
- 52.210.18.249
- 23.88.167.43
- 46.149.195.22
- 154.220.70.28
- 207.60.59.189
- 121.37.133.170
- 104.148.103.93
- 38.31.129.68
